On 07/03/2013 11:51 PM, Zhang Yanfei wrote:
> On 07/03/2013 11:28 PM, Michal Hocko wrote:
>> On Wed 03-07-13 17:34:15, Joonsoo Kim wrote:
>> [...]
>>> For one page allocation at once, this patchset makes allocator slower than
>>> before (-5%). 
>>
>> Slowing down the most used path is a no-go. Where does this slow down
>> come from?
> 
> I guess, it might be: for one page allocation at once, comparing to the original
> code, this patch adds two parameters nr_pages and pages and will do extra checks
> for the parameter nr_pages in the allocation path.
> 

If so, adding a separate path for the multiple allocations seems better.
